On 01/23/12 15:33, Brian Cameron wrote:

Ali/Stefan:

Odd, I notice that when I run "make publish" in components/gnupg on
my machine running S11u1 build 5, that the built gpg2 program seems to
link against /lib/libcurses.so and does not seem to have the problem
in CR #7098984. Oddly, I do not notice any "-lcurses" in the
"make publish" output.

Is this because the bug is actually already fixed somehow, or is
this bug just caused because we build GnuPG on S11 FCS?


7051963 was fixed in s11u1_03, so that does explain what you're
seeing. The gate is still building on s11fcs as you note.

I've had a couple of emails saying that a CBE change is coming,
so perhaps the best fix here is to do nothing for now, and close
this when the switch happens. I guess it comes down to how much
pain gpg2 is causing folks in the meantime.

Note that -zignore prior to 7051963 (which is a sweeping reimplementation
of that feature) was always inadequate for Userland --- we just didn't
know that when the blanket application was done. Fortunately, 7051963
just happened to already be in the pipe.
